Two major effects of the French and Indian War were the significant territorial gains for Britain in North America, including Canada and lands east of the Mississippi River, which altered the balance of power on the continent. Additionally, the war led to increased tensions between Britain and its American colonies due to rising war debts, prompting Britain to impose new taxes and regulations, ultimately contributing to colonial discontent and the push for independence.
